63 films areheld out of the ranking: their lifetime gross folds in decades of re-releases, so dividing by the release year's ticket price would invent tickets. They appear with a † below the ranked rows rather than being silently seated above Gone with the Wind.
Method.A gross is trapped in its own era's ticket prices, so to show it in 1997 dollars you divide by what a ticket cost the year it opened and multiply by what one cost in 1997 ($4.69, measured). That is the classic site's actual adjusted method, run to any year instead of only to today. Grosses are lifetime domestic, so a film that kept playing after 1997 carries its full run — the same reading the old chart gave. Films marked †are excluded from the ranking: their gross is a lifetime total folding in decades of re-releases, so it cannot be pinned to a single year's prices.
